Charter Duration
The duration of your yacht charter plays a pivotal role in determining the overall cost. In Turkey, yacht charters are typically priced on a weekly basis. Longer charter durations usually come with substantial discounts. Hence, when planning your budget, consider the duration of your journey, as it will significantly impact the total expenses.
Type and Size of Yacht
Selecting the right yacht involves a careful consideration of your budget and preferences. In Turkey, various types of yachts are available, each offering a distinct set of features and amenities:
Motor Yachts:
These yachts provide speed and comfort but are often associated with a higher price point.
Sailing Yachts:
Ideal for those seeking a classic sailing experience at a more budget-friendly rate.
Catamarans:
Known for their stability and spaciousness, catamarans come in a range of prices. They are particularly appealing to those seeking a balance between luxury and budget.
Choosing the yacht that aligns with your group size, desired level of comfort, and budget is a critical decision.
Savings Tips
For a more cost-effective yacht charter experience in Turkey, consider the following tips:
Early Booking Discounts: Many yacht charter companies incentivize early bookings by offering discounts. By securing your plans well in advance, you can take advantage of these cost-saving opportunities.
Prefer Off-Peak Seasons: Opting for yacht charters just before or after the peak summer season can translate to more affordable rates. You can enjoy the beauty of Turkey’s coasts with fewer crowds and lower expenses.
Bareboat Charter: If you possess sailing experience or relevant certifications, you may explore the option of bareboat charter. This approach allows you to take control of the yacht without the need for additional crew members, thereby reducing crew costs.
Factors Affecting Yacht Charter Costs in Turkey
To gain a comprehensive understanding of yacht charter costs, consider the following factors:
Charter Fee: Yacht charter prices vary based on the yacht’s specifications, age, size, and brand. Newer and more luxurious yachts generally come with higher price tags.
Crew Gratuity: While it’s not mandatory, it’s customary to provide gratuities to the crew as a token of appreciation for their efforts in making your trip enjoyable.
APA (Advanced Provisioning Allowance): The APA is an additional fee that covers various expenses such as fuel, food, beverages, and port fees. It typically represents around 20-30% of the charter fee.
Seasonal Considerations: The timing of your yacht charter can significantly impact the cost. The peak summer season is usually associated with higher prices due to increased demand. If your schedule allows, consider the advantages of exploring the coasts during the shoulder seasons, which are known for more moderate pricing and pleasant weather.
